Building a new home is a significant undertaking, but if approached with the right mindset and preparation, it can be an exciting and rewarding experience. Here are some important factors to bear in mind when embarking on your home construction journey.
Firstly, pay attention to details. A home is a lifetime investment, and any error at the initial stage can be expensive. To avoid regrettable decisions, spend adequate time conceptualizing your design. Take into account your needs, the number of family members, and your personal style when planning the layout and room sizes.
Secondly, choose the right building materials. The type of materials you select will significantly affect your home’s durability, maintenance, and overall aesthetic. Consider factors such as local climate, budget, and personal preference when selecting materials.
Thirdly, employ a trustworthy builder. Your contractor is your partner in this significant endeavor. Make sure they have a good reputation, strong recommendations, and are at ease with your selected design and materials.
Fourthly, remember to incorporate sustainability. Going green in home construction is not only good for the planet, but it can also result in significant long-term savings. Think about using energy-saving appliances, solar energy, and water-efficient fixtures.
Finally, be patient and flexible. Home construction is a complicated process that can encounter unexpected delays and obstacles. Be equipped to change your plans and expectations as needed.
To sum up, building a new home can be a fulfilling experience if done right. Remember to plan meticulously, choose the right materials, hire a reliable contractor, incorporate sustainability, and be patient and flexible. By following these essential tips, you can construct a home that fulfills your requirements and withstands the test of time.
